Going North St Pancras, MR poster, 1910

Poster produced for the Midland Railway (MR) to promote services to the north of England from St Pancras Station, in London. The poster shows an interior view of St Pancras where passengers are seen on the busy platforms, awaiting trains and viewing bookstalls. Artwork by Fred Taylor (1875-1963), who was commissioned in 1930 to design four ceiling paintings for the Underwriting Room at Lloyds and murals for Reeds Lacquer Room. He exhibited at the Royal Academy and other London galleries and worked for the Empire Marketing Board, LNER, London Transport and several shipping companies
